RACS Visitor Grant Program
RACS is committed to excellence in surgical education and practice and recognised that Fellows within sub-specialties and other groups wish to enhance their annual scientific meetings by inviting scientific visitors of note, from Australia, New Zealand and internationally. RACS will support these initiatives through the RACS Visitor Grant Program.
Groups are invited to apply for funding towards the cost of travel, accommodation and registration for their 2023 visitor(s). Applications are open to any recognised society or association of surgeons.
What if our visitor cannot attend in person because of COVID-19 restrictions?
As it stands, the funding allocation can only be used to cover the flights, accommodation and registration of in-person overseas visitors – and cannot be used to cover the costs of virtual conferencing platforms and other costs. This is in accordance of the RACS Visitor Grant Program (For Non-RACS Meetings) policy.
